Welcome to on-call for the Brimvale queue-depth autoscaler. The scaler polls the Fennet broker every 15 seconds and adds workers when depth exceeds 500 messages per partition. Scale-downs are delayed ten minutes to avoid flapping. If the scaler itself crashes, the supervisor restarts it automatically; three restarts in an hour pages you. Manual overrides go through the ops CLI and must be signed before the controller accepts them. Sign override payloads with the deploy key below.

rollout seal: bky4_x7Gc

Hello plugin authors — the cut-over to the new Mergewell deduplication pipeline for customer records finished this weekend. Merge decisions now come from the unified scoring engine, and the legacy pairwise matcher is retired. Plugins that hook merge events will receive the new payload shape immediately; survivor selection callbacks are unchanged. Backfill of historical merges completes midweek. Please validate your integrations against the sandbox before Friday. The pipeline now runs with the following configuration values.

settings of fafog-haduf:
ZORIX_PIN=4648
ZORIX_METRICS_HOST=metrics.zorix.paliqsys.corp
ZORIX_LOG_LEVEL=info
ZORIX_TENANT=druix

/*
 * Client setup for the Wrenholt wiki's role-based access service.
 * Roles (viewer, editor, steward) are resolved server-side by the
 * Pelling authz API; never cache role grants locally for more than
 * five minutes, or revocations won't take effect promptly. The
 * client authenticates with the staging key that follows below.
 */

gateway credential: kto23_dolYgAScEh2TaPOlStqOl98

The Keyhollow reset flow replaces email-only tokens with channel-agnostic challenges. Plugins implement `deliver(challenge)` and `verify(response)`; the core owns token issuance, expiry, and rate limiting. Plugins must not persist raw tokens. Hooks fire on issue, verify, and expire; all are synchronous with a hard deadline, after which the core aborts the plugin and falls back to email. Challenge lifetimes and attempt caps are enforced centrally and are not overridable per plugin. The enforced tuning constants follow.

limits module of yadug-tawip:
QUOTAS = {
    "julael": 705,
    "kasael": 903,
    "druwyn": 489,
}